Introduction to Plasma Spraying Technology
Plasma spraying is a thermal spraying process that uses a plasma arc as the heat source and primarily employs spray powder materials.
① Steps of plasma spraying
During plasma spraying, a direct-current arc is generated between the cathode and the anode (nozzle). This arc heats and ionizes the introduced working gas into a high-temperature plasma, which is then ejected from the nozzle to form a plasma jet. Powder particles are fed into the plasma jet by a powder-feeding gas, where they are melted, accelerated, and sprayed onto the substrate material to form a coating. The working gas can be argon, nitrogen, or a mixture of these gases with hydrogen added; alternatively, a mixed gas of argon and helium can also be used.
② Characteristics of plasma spraying
(1) Capable of spraying a variety of coating materials, especially high-melting-point and refractory materials such as refractory metals, ceramics, metal-ceramics, and other special functional materials;
(2) Inert gases can be selected as the working medium to reduce oxidative reactions of spray particles during their flight.
(3) The coating exhibits high bonding strength and low porosity; fine coatings can be prepared by controlling process parameters.
③ Main equipment for plasma spraying
Including the spray gun, powder feeding mechanism, rectifier current, air supply system, water cooling system, and control system.
Introduction to the Configuration of the SX-80 Plasma Spraying Equipment
The SX-80 plasma coating equipment was developed successfully based on the introduction and absorption of plasma spraying equipment such as the PT-A3000 and METCO-9M. Its overall performance level is comparable to that of the METCO-9M.
This equipment consists of the following systems: ① main power supply ② control cabinet ③ junction box ④ powder feeder ⑤ gas-electric safety center ⑥ spray gun ⑦ heat exchanger and piping connections, among others.
